Linus Torvalds သည် Linux kernel ရှိ i486 CPU အတွက် အဆုံးသတ်ပံ့ပိုးမှုကို အဆိုပြုခဲ့သည်။

"cmpxchg86b" ညွှန်ကြားချက်ကိုမပံ့ပိုးသော x8 ပရိုဆက်ဆာများအတွက် ဖြေရှင်းနည်းများကို ဆွေးနွေးနေစဉ်တွင်၊ Linus Torvalds က "cmpxchg486b" ကိုမပံ့ပိုးနိုင်သော i8 ပရိုဆက်ဆာများအတွက် အထောက်အပံ့ကို ချထားရန် အချိန်တန်ပြီဟု Linus Torvalds မှ ပြောကြားခဲ့ပါသည်။ ဘယ်သူမှ အသုံးမပြုတော့တဲ့ ပရိုဆက်ဆာတွေမှာ ဒီညွှန်ကြားချက်ရဲ့ လုပ်ဆောင်ချက်ကို အတုယူဖို့ ကြိုးစားနေမယ့်အစား။ လက်ရှိတွင်၊ 32-bit x86 စနစ်များကို ဆက်လက်ပံ့ပိုးပေးသည့် Linux ဖြန့်ဝေမှုအားလုံးနီးပါးသည် "cmpxchg86b" ပံ့ပိုးမှုလိုအပ်သည့် X8_PAE ရွေးချယ်မှုဖြင့် kernel တည်ဆောက်ခြင်းသို့ ပြောင်းသွားပါသည်။

Linus ၏ အဆိုအရ၊ kernel ပံ့ပိုးမှု၏ ရှုထောင့်မှကြည့်လျှင် i486 ပရိုဆက်ဆာများသည် နေ့စဉ်ဘဝတွင် တွေ့နေရဆဲဖြစ်သော်လည်း ၎င်းတို့၏ ဆက်စပ်မှုကို ဆုံးရှုံးသွားခဲ့သည်။ တစ်ချိန်တည်းတွင်၊ ပရိုဆက်ဆာများသည် ပြတိုက်များ၏ ပြပွဲများဖြစ်လာပြီး ၎င်းတို့အတွက် “museum” cores များဖြင့် သွားလာရန် အတော်လေး ဖြစ်နိုင်ချေရှိသည်။ i486 ပရိုဆက်ဆာများဖြင့် စနစ်များရှိနေသေးသော အသုံးပြုသူများသည် နောင်နှစ်ပေါင်းများစွာအထိ ပံ့ပိုးပေးမည့် LTS kernel ထုတ်ဝေမှုများကို အသုံးပြုနိုင်မည် ဖြစ်သည်။

ဂန္ထဝင် i486s များအတွက် ပံ့ပိုးမှုရပ်ဆိုင်းခြင်းသည် i486 အတန်းနှင့် သက်ဆိုင်သော်လည်း၊ "cmpxchg8b" အပါအဝင် Intel ၏ ထည့်သွင်းထားသော Quark ပရိုဆက်ဆာများအပေါ် သက်ရောက်မှုရှိမည်မဟုတ်ပါ။ Vortex86DX ပရိုဆက်ဆာများနှင့် အလားတူသည်။ i386 ပရိုဆက်ဆာများအတွက် ပံ့ပိုးမှုကို လွန်ခဲ့သော 10 နှစ်က kernel တွင် ရပ်ဆိုင်းခဲ့သည်။

source: opennet.ru

မှတ်ချက် Add